#9a5805 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9a5805 is composed of 60.4% red, 34.5%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 33.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 31.2%. #9a5805 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b00a with #350000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#9a5805 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#9a5805 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9a5805 has RGB values of R:154, G:88,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.97,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10115077.

Shades and Tints of #9a5805
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fef7ee is the lightest one.
